The National Institute of Food and Agriculture (NIFA) is putting a call out for volunteers to serve as industry relevance reviewers for pre-applications to the Specialty Crop Research Initiative (SCRI).
“The SCRI awards grants to support research that addresses the critical needs of the specialty crop industry, and it is crucial to have knowledgeable volunteers engaged in the review process to ensure the projects funded by SCRI are indeed relevant to industry,” said Hank Giclas, senior vice president of science, technology & strategic planning at Western Growers.
